Overview
The Flow Pro 6W is a dual-stone solar pond aerator with MPPT battery
management, designed to support oxygen levels in medium to large ponds.
A 6W solar panel charges the integrated LiFe battery to extend aeration
beyond peak daylight hours, with two air stones for wider distribution.
6W high-efficiency solar panel
LiFe battery backup with MPPT control
3 LPM total airflow output
500 mmHg maximum air pressure
Dual 30 mm air stones included
Brushless DC pump motor
Up to 18.5 hours on sunny days
Minimum 10.5 hours per full charge
3 m cable from pump to panel
Designed for spring and summer use
CE, UKCA, RoHS and REACH certified

Dual-Stone Aeration for Wider Coverage
Two air stones help spread aeration more evenly across the pond. Position
the stones in separate areas to improve circulation and support oxygen
transfer where fish tend to gather in warm conditions.

Solar Panel + Battery Backup with MPPT
The 6W panel charges the integrated LiFe battery so the aerator can
continue running beyond peak sun. MPPT power management helps optimise
charging and output when light levels vary through the day. As with all
solar aeration, runtime depends on season, placement and sunlight.
Solar Panel
6W Grade A polycrystalline panel
Rated efficiency above 21%
7.68 V nominal panel voltage
651 mA nominal panel current
Battery System
LiFe battery 6.4V 3000mAh
MPPT charging optimisation
Maintenance-light battery design
Integrated power management
Runtime Guidance
Minimum 10.5 hours per charge
Up to 18.5 hours on sunny days
Best results in spring and summer

Optimisation Tips
Small placement adjustments can make a noticeable difference to daily
output. Focus on sunlight exposure and stone positioning.
Stone Placement
Place stones in separate pond zones
Avoid burying stones in heavy silt
Keep hoses clear of sharp edges
Panel Position
Mount panel in full direct sunlight
Avoid shade during peak hours
Adjust angle as seasons change
Routine Care
Wipe panel clean when dusty
Inspect hoses for kinks or splits
Clean stones if airflow reduces
